- [ ] **Step 7: Breaker override escrow.** After sealing the signing keys for the Tallgrove upstream API circuit breaker, confirm the support team can force the breaker open during a full outage. The override bundle lives in the sealed escrow drawer and is useless without its unlock phrase. Two ceremony witnesses must initial this step before proceeding. The escrow bundle is decrypted with the recovery passphrase that follows.

vault phrase of kahip-kahop = holath-quenmir

Handover note — Crumbwheel order cutoffs.

Welcome aboard. The bakery cutoff rule in Crumbwheel closes same-day orders at 14:00 local to each storefront, not UTC — this has bitten us twice. Holiday overrides live in the calendar service and take precedence silently, so always check there first when a cutoff looks wrong. To unlock the calendar service's admin console after a restart, enter the recovery passphrase below.

vault phrase of bagap-bahaf = silion-pelox-sorox-casdor-quenwyn-fraax-eliox-praael-kelion-quenvan-kasox-rusael-norius-belvan

Subject: Key rotation for the hermetic build migration

Team,

As part of migrating Ironquill builds to the Hermeta build system, we rotated the artifact-fetch credentials today. On-call: if a nightly build fails with an auth error, update the build environment before retrying; old keys stop working at midnight. The new staging key for the Hermeta artifact service follows.

gateway credential: kto3_qfe